BACKGROUND: 

WSOC: “The White House estimates the House’s American Rescue Plan will provide North Carolina with $5.3 billion in state fiscal relief, $3.8 billion in local fiscal relief and more than $3.9 billion in relief for K-12 schools, according to figures shared with Channel 9.”

  • $1,400 checks for people making under $75,000 and $2,800 checks for married couples making under $150,000.
  • Additional relief of up to $1,600 per child through the Child Tax Credit to the families of 924,000 children, lifting 137,000 children out of poverty
  • Additional relief of up to nearly $1,000 through the Earned Income Tax Credit to 603,000 childless workers, including many in frontline jobs
  • Monthly increase in nutrition assistance of about $27 per person for 1,463,000 people, according to the most recent estimates
  • Marketplace health insurance premiums that are $800 lower per month for a family of four earning $120,000 per year

The overwhelming majority of Americans, including more than half of Republicans, support President Biden’s American Rescue Plan.  

  • According to a new Morning Consult poll, 76 percent of Americans say they support President Biden’s stimulus package.
  • That same poll shows that more than half of Republican voters support the plan. By a two-to-one margin, Republicans support the plan 60 percent to 30 percent.
